Now comes the really fun part of customizing your BigCommerce online shop!
In your admin page, click on “Design Mode” and then on “Open my site in design mode”
Here you can move the blocks around to suit what you would like.
The next tab you should look at is the ‘mobile’ tab. It is very important that you activate this. This makes it possible that your clients can access your BigCommerce Online Shop via their smartphones. There aren’t any step by step information for that. You can just confirm that you want this feature.
The next tab is the ‘email’ tab. These emails are emails that are automatically sent to your customers. You can click on ‘edit’ for each one of them and change the wording to what you’d like. But usually the defaults are more than adequate.
On the header tab, you will be able to change the header image of your BigCommerce Online store. Make sure that your new image is the exact same size as the one shown under the tab.
The last tab is the template files. If you do not know what you are doing, please DO NOT change anything there!

URL Structure
The URL Structure of you site is very important. Always use SEO Optimized (long) as Google tends to show sites that have keywords in the URL’s first. For instance, if you are selling books it will work like this:
First you get the category – Books and then subcategory – eBooks and then your product – Sell products online.
Your URL will read: http://mystore.mybigcommerce.com/books/ebooks/sell-products-online/ This means that you have two short keywords – books, ebooks – and one longtailed keyword – sell-products-online – in your URL. The chances of your product showing up in Google search has just been multiplied!

Miscellaneous Settings
I would like to draw your attention to the Google Maps API key. Why is Google Maps important? By using Google maps you increase your visibility in ‘area based searches’ and please follow the step by step instructions to get your Google Maps API Key for your BigCommerce online store.
Click on “I have read and agree ….”, enter your BigCommerce Online Store URL here.
Click on Generate API Key. If you aren’t logged in with your gmail address, you will be asked to log in or create a new one. You will be redirected to your key after login/signup.
Copy the key and return to your online store and paste the key in the block provided.
